| sviluppatori@openspcoop.org |
|---|
|
|
| To: | <sviluppatori@openspcoop.org> |
|---|---|
| Subject: | R: [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2) |
| From: | "Montebove Luciano" <L.Montebove@finsiel.it> |
| Date: | Tue, 16 May 2006 11:48:17 +0200 |
| Cc: | |
| List-archive: | </pipermail/sviluppatori> |
| List-help: | <mailto:sviluppatori-request@openspcoop.org?subject=help> |
| List-id: | sviluppatori.openspcoop.org |
| List-post: | <mailto:sviluppatori@openspcoop.org> |
| List-subscribe: | <http://www.openspcoop.org/mailman/listinfo/sviluppatori>,<mailto:sviluppatori-request@openspcoop.org?subject=subscribe> |
| List-unsubscribe: | <http://www.openspcoop.org/mailman/listinfo/sviluppatori>,<mailto:sviluppatori-request@openspcoop.org?subject=unsubscribe> |
| Reply-to: | sviluppatori@openspcoop.org |
| Thread-index: | AcZ4KgSQLQtqsCluQii0is8lGYPlXQAn6YlQ |
| Thread-topic: | [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2) |
Andrea, ho fatto dei test facendomi scrivere da WSSReceiver e WSSSender
l'envelope SOAP prima e dopo la invoke di WSDoAllReceiver e WSDoAllSender.
Nel caso di WSSReceiver prendo l'envelope SOAP dopo la chiamata a
envelope.getHeader().extractHeaderElements(actor);
in modo da verificare l'eliminazione dell'header WSS. Questa avviene
regolarmente anche nel caso di 'sbustamento-soap=false'. Lo puoi verificare con
la versione di WSSReceiver allegata.
Il problema è che però al WSSSender in input arriva l'envelope originale con
l'header WSS.
E' come se nella preparazione della risposta venisse usato il messaggio
originale, non quello ripulito dall'header WSS.
Mi spieghi meglio la differenza di comportamento tra 'sbustamento-soap=false' e
'sbustamento-soap=true'?
P.S.
Se mi mandi un tel. In privato magari ne parliamo un attimo.
Ciao
Luciano
>Ho provato a fare il porting di OpenSPCoop verso axis 1.4 Funziona tutto
>correttamente, salvo l'utilizzo di porte applicative con il parametro
>'sbustamento-soap=false'.
>La validazione WSS fallisce poiche' si presenta di nuovo il problema del
>NON-consumo dell'header WSS prodotto da OpenSPCoop, dopo l'utilizzo .
>Ho pubblicato sul CVS la versione di OpenSPCoop che utilizza axis 1.4.
>Rimane da risolvere l'eliminazione dell'header WSS dalla busta ricevuta.
>
>Andrea.
|
| <Prev in Thread] | Current Thread | [Next in Thread> |
| ||
| Previous by Date: | Re: [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2), Andrea Poli |
| Next by Date: | Re: R: [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2), Andrea Poli |
| Previous by Thread: | [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2), Montebove Luciano |
| Next by Thread: | Re: R: [OpenSPCoop-Dev] Interoperabilità con WS-Security e nuova versione WSS4J ed Axis (1/2), Andrea Poli |
| Indexes: | [Date] [Thread] |